On Sunday, Feb. 16, former Oak Ridge High School standout Grace Kilday’s current college team, the UC Davis Aggies, lost 13-5 in their NCAA Division I softball game against the Stanford Cardinals.

The game took place at Stanford Stadium. This was their second matchup against the Cardinals this season.

The Aggies’ next game is scheduled for Thursday, Feb. 20 at 2:30 p.m. at Rita Hillenbrand Memorial Stadium against Stanford Cardinals.
